Instrument resources - Accessible Instrument and Technology Library
Somerset Music has developed this library to allow schools to hire a range of accessible and adaptable instruments for use in lessons. The aim of this library is for every young person to have access to instruments and technology that fuels their interests and meets their abilities and needs.
It is also a resource for teachers to ensure they are able to use accessible instruments and technology effectively in both curriculum and instrumental teaching contexts.
The library is designed to be:
- Comprehensive – meeting the full range of needs found in both mainstream and specialist settings, including alternative provision.
- Useable by all – Resources are accessible to both specialist music teachers and generalist classroom teachers.

About Arcana Strum
Accessibility
- Designed with SEND Learning in Mind.
- The main feature is a handle that mimics the sensation of strumming a guitar: the company behind the Strum, Arcana, have created the Strum so that it can be adapted and are happy to support where they can and will consider providing/designing different handle attachments – even custom ones. Several of these are available. If the perfect handle doesn’t exist, what might it look like?
- Chord sounds with the press of a button.
- Specifically crafted for the assistive technology market.
- Compact.
- Adjustable keys and handle sensitivity, to adapt to the needs of different users.
- Supports both right and left-handed playing.
- The Arcana eBox (approx. £80) is an adaptive device that allows individuals with different physical abilities to play the Arcana Strum instrument using accessible switches and sensors.
About ODDball
Accessibility
The ODDball is designed to react to movements, even very gentle ones. The ball is fully customisable to meet the needs of learner’s motor skills by programming the ball to respond to gentle taps, shakes or throws. It is very durable and can withstand frequent throwing onto hard surfaces.

About Recordable Buttons
Accessibility
Very easy to use with just press and hold mechanism for young children, and the slide button function for older children and young people.
